Forces kill seven militants in North Waziristan

RAWALPINDI: Security forces have killed seven Indian-Sponsored militants of Fitna al Khawarij in North Waziristan tribal district of Khyber Pakhtunkhwa, said a military statement on Tuesday.

According to the ISPR, the security forces have launched two separate operations of the district.

The operations were carried out on the basis of intelligence.

The forces successfully launched targets on the havens of the militants.

One of the operation was launched in the Mir Ali area whereas the other attack was carried out in the Spinwam area of North Waziristan.

The Khawarij were involved in the attacks on the innocent civilians as well as on the security forces.

The security forces recovered large haul of weapons .e.g SMG, explosives, IEDs and maps from the militants.

The security forces continue the search and clearance operation in the area.

Sanitization operations are being conducted to eliminate any other Indian sponsored kharji found in the area as relentless Counter Terrorism campaign under vision “Azm e Istehkam” (as approved by Federal Apex Committee on National Action Plan) by Security Forces.

Law Enforcement Agencies of Pakistan will continue at full pace to wipe out menace of foreign sponsored and supported terrorism from the country.
